Watson and Holmes straightened up from their grisly discovery of the cardboard box, the good doctor overcome with horror. "My Lord Holmes!" he exclaimed. "Do you think one of those are hers?"

"Calm yourself, Watson," his friend replied. "Both of those are very masculine ears - I am sure your wife is perfectly safe... Whereas we might not be so lucky." His attention had been caught by the strange apparition on the far side of the road. A child, sitting in a tall tree, wearing a bright yellow mask. With one hand the small figure gripped a stout branch for balance, the other hand was pointed out towards the gravel drive.


In the drive, three very stout Finnish men had appeared, one of whom carried a pistol - the business end pointed directly at Holmes and Watson. "You're to come with us," he barked. "And keep your distance, Mister Holmes. Your reputation at fisticuffs is well known... You can believe that we won't be taking any chances."


"What do we do?" Watson whispered in alarm.


"Why, we go with them," was the reply. "Today the Finnish carry the field...."


-----------------------------


The Finns do have an excellent turn - netting themselves three builds with a string of successful occupations. The rest of the action across the board stabilizes, with the Poles and the Russians exchanging southern centers and Sweden trusting the Fins just one step too far.

Spring 954: it shouldn't come as a big surprise that another region was set on fire.
Nor as to which Power was responsible for deploying the Scorched Earth strategy this time.
Toulouse, region between the Atlantic Ocean and the Mediterranean Sea, and once the prosperous center between France and the Arab Caliphates, reduced to smoldering fields and villages. Caught between the Arabs and Burgundians the French army backed up until they were driven into the sea. No French survivors were reported. So now the French civilization and its future rest upon the shoulders of its armies in Tours and Nantes.

The Romans and the Slavs have reported heavy fighting in the Khazar Empire; all neighboring regions seem to have been involved and the Romans managed to hold their position.
Heavy fighting also in the Sea of England: the Danes with the support from Burgundy outnumbered the attacking Norse and drove them back.
The Slavic army in the mountainous region of Tirol was completely surprised by the overwhelming force the Burgundians had deployed; no survivors.
The army of the independent city of Alexandria was no match for the Roman forces and has surrendered. So after the independent city of Jorsal, now Alexandria has fallen too.

DC201 - Viking Victory conditions - test_gm   (Sep 13, 2007, 12:00 am)
After 2 weeks, with a small margin, the votes were cast in favor of changing the victory conditions as suggested to reflect the changing number of Supply Centers on the map due to the Scorched Earth variant.

This means that
the Viking Victory conditions for a Solo now require a minimum of 26 SCs or 50% of the total SCs remaining.
